Where is the DK Coin in Fish Food Frenzy?
DK Coin (3:24): At the end of the level in the flagpole area jump up onto dry land & use Kiddy to throw Dixie up onto the high up ledge to the left. Use the Steel Keg to kill Koin.

How do you get DK coins in Springin spider?
The Kongs must stand on the Koin’s shield. They must throw the Steel Barrel at the nearest wall for it to bounce back, hit the Koin in the side, and defeat it. The Kongs automatically obtain DK Coin.

Where is the DK Coin in squeals on wheels?
The Kongs must pick up the Steel Barrel and throw it at the wall behind the Koin, causing it to bounce off into the Koin and defeat it. The Kongs are then rewarded a DK Coin.
How do you get DK coins in rocket barrel ride?
The Kongs must quickly jump into an Auto-Fire Barrel above a waterfall to blast all the way to the left behind Koin. As Kongs faces left at the Kongs, the Steel Barrel hits it from behind, defeating it and rewarding the DK Coin to the Kongs.
What are DK coins used for?
DK Coins in Donkey Kong Land III are used to enter the Lost World after Baron K. Roolenstein is beaten in Tin Can Valley. All DK Coins and Watches need to be found before the last fight with Baron K. Roolenstein.
